To
make a difference in the lives of your children, you need to give them more
than love. You need parenting skills to guide your children effectively in
everyday situations.
Situational Parenting® formally extends the application of the Situational
Leadership Model from the conference table to the kitchen table.

More than a
compilation of tips and tricks for good parenting, Situational Parenting®
provides participants with a new model for understanding a child's unique
readiness level for a variety of everyday tasks. Based on the child's
readiness level, parents then learn how to adapt their own style to more
positively influence the child. Unique features of the
Situational Parenting®
Program include:
•
Parent Self-Assessment -
a self-scored
questionnaire designed to provide feedback
on current parenting behaviors
• Situational Simulator -
a fast-paced
game to test learning under "real world"
circumstances
• Parent Promises -
a concrete action plan
to solidify behavior change and create alignment
with other parenting partners.
